The Types of Chemicals and Their Persistence

The derailment released a cocktail of hazardous chemicals, many of which are known carcinogens and pose significant long-term health risks. Understanding the nature and persistence of these chemicals is crucial to addressing the ongoing crisis.

Vinyl Chloride and its Lingering Effects

Vinyl chloride, a highly volatile and carcinogenic substance, was a primary concern in the immediate aftermath. Its volatility means it can easily spread through air and potentially contaminate porous building materials like drywall, insulation, and even carpeting. The lingering effects are a significant worry.

  • Health Risks: Long-term exposure to vinyl chloride is linked to an increased risk of liver cancer, brain cancer, and other serious health problems. Even low-level exposure over extended periods can have detrimental effects.
  • Detection and Removal Challenges: Detecting and removing vinyl chloride residues from buildings is incredibly difficult. Specialized equipment and expertise are required, and the process can be costly and time-consuming. Complete eradication is often impossible.

Other Hazardous Chemicals

Beyond vinyl chloride, other hazardous chemicals released in the derailment, such as butyl acrylate and ethylhexyl acrylate, pose additional long-term risks. These chemicals are known irritants and can cause respiratory problems, skin irritation, and other health issues.

  • Health Effects: The health effects associated with these chemicals can range from mild irritation to severe respiratory distress, depending on the level and duration of exposure. Long-term effects are not fully understood.
  • Assessment and Remediation Challenges: Assessing and remediating the diverse range of chemical contaminants presents significant analytical and logistical challenges. Different chemicals require different remediation strategies, adding complexity to the clean-up efforts.

Assessing and Mitigating Contamination in Buildings

Determining the extent of contamination and implementing effective remediation strategies are crucial steps in protecting the health of East Palestine residents.

Challenges in Detection and Remediation

Identifying and removing chemical residues from buildings presents numerous challenges. The diverse range of building materials and the potential for chemicals to penetrate deeply into surfaces complicate the process.

  • Specialized Testing and Equipment: Advanced analytical techniques and specialized equipment are necessary to accurately assess the extent and type of contamination within buildings. This often requires expensive laboratory analysis.
  • Costs and Logistical Challenges: The remediation process can be incredibly expensive, requiring demolition and replacement of contaminated materials in many cases. The logistical challenges of coordinating such extensive work are also substantial.

The Role of Government and Private Agencies

The Environmental Protection Agency (EPA), local authorities, and private contractors all play crucial roles in addressing building contamination. However, coordination and clear guidelines are vital.

  • Funding Sources and Assistance Programs: The federal government and potentially other organizations may offer funding and assistance programs for residents affected by the contamination. Accessing these resources is critical.
  • Lack of Clear Guidelines and Protocols: A lack of established protocols for remediation of this scale adds to the complexity and uncertainty faced by residents and authorities alike.

Health Concerns and Long-Term Impacts

The potential long-term health consequences for East Palestine residents exposed to chemical residues are a major concern.

Potential Health Effects of Long-Term Exposure

Long-term exposure to the chemicals released in the derailment could lead to a wide range of health problems, including:

  • Cancer: Several of the chemicals involved are known or suspected carcinogens, raising significant concerns about long-term cancer risks.
  • Respiratory Issues: Exposure to these chemicals can cause various respiratory problems, from irritation to chronic lung disease.
  • Reproductive Problems: Some of the chemicals involved are also linked to reproductive problems and developmental issues.
  • Psychological Impact: The stress and uncertainty surrounding the contamination have a significant psychological impact on affected residents.

Monitoring and Ongoing Health Surveillance

Long-term health monitoring programs are crucial to track the health outcomes of exposed residents.

  • Early Detection and Intervention: Early detection of health problems allows for timely intervention, potentially mitigating long-term consequences.
  • Challenges in Tracking Health Outcomes: Tracking health outcomes related to specific chemical exposures is complex, requiring detailed epidemiological studies and robust data collection.
